German military maps don't usually have any Swastikas on them. They are commonly marked as Heereskarte or some similar designation. These all look like civilian maps. Grosser Berlin or Greater Berlin suggests war time to me or just prior. Recall what happened to Berlin after the war? NH
I like them! These are really cool items to have and you can have a lot of fun researching landmarks. I'm certain now after s closer look that these are all pre-war. At some point, tourist maps with landmarks on them would have ceased production. Clues for dates include landmarks, adverts and the art style utilized in layout. I'm guessing 1930s. NH
